Key Properties
-
High Density (≈17 g/cm³ - 18 g/cm³) – Provides excellent mass and weight concentration, making it ideal for counterweights and radiation shielding.
-
Superior Strength & Hardness – The tungsten matrix ensures high mechanical strength, wear resistance, and durability under heavy loads.
-
Good Corrosion Resistance – Compared to tungsten-nickel-iron (W-Ni-Fe) alloys, W-Ni-Cu exhibits superior corrosion resistance, especially in marine and chemical environments.
-
Non-Magnetic Behavior – Unlike W-Ni-Fe, this alloy is non-magnetic, making it suitable for applications where magnetism must be avoided.
-
Moderate Electrical & Thermal Conductivity – While not as conductive as tungsten-copper, it still provides sufficient thermal dissipation for some high-performance applications.
-
Good Machinability – The addition of nickel and copper improves the material’s workability, allowing for precision machining and shaping.
Applications
-
Aerospace & Defense – Used in counterweights, gyroscopes, and kinetic energy penetrators.
-
Radiation Shielding – Ideal for X-ray and gamma-ray shielding in medical and industrial applications.
-
Balancing Weights – Applied in automotive, aircraft, and sports equipment to achieve precise weight distribution.
-
Marine & Chemical Industry Components – Suitable for environments where corrosion resistance is critical.
-
Electrical Discharge Machining (EDM) Electrodes – Offers moderate conductivity and durability for specialized machining applications.
